Appearance
變量 ?
變量用于存儲值,可以在整個工作流程中訪問這些值。
例如,您可以將獲取文本塊檢索到的文本存儲在變量中,并在其他組件中訪問該變量。
變量命名 ?
您可以為變量指定任意名稱。但為了更方便地在表達式標記中訪問變量,建議不要在變量名稱中包含空格、@符號和方括號([])。
變量前綴 ?
MakAgent 在變量或命令的名稱中使用前綴來指示特定目的或功能。
$$ 前綴 ?
$$ 前綴表示設(shè)置或訪問存儲在存儲中的變量值。
- 另請參閱:存儲
$push: 前綴 ?
當使用 $push: 作為前綴時,MakAgent 會將變量值的數(shù)據(jù)類型更改為數(shù)組。如果變量已有值,該值將成為數(shù)組的第一項。當為變量賦值時,MakAgent 不會替換變量值,而是將該值推入數(shù)組中。
示例:假設(shè)您正在循環(huán)遍歷元素,使用獲取元素塊獲取元素文本,并將文本放入以 $push: 為前綴的變量中,如 $push:texts:
- 第一次迭代:
texts變量值為["Text 1"] - 第二次迭代:
texts變量值為["Text 2"] - 以此類推
MakAgent在線文檔